How Your Plant Can Lower its Bills Using Power Factor Correction
By Stewart Thompson, CAS DataLoggers Power Factor (PF) is the ratio of real power to the apparent power flowing to the load from the source. From a business standpoint it’s important to understand how having a low Power Factor raises your plant or factory’s power bill. -

Honeywell to upgrade icy offshore platform in Russia
In spite of cold as low as -70F, Honeywell will upgrade process control with an Experion Process Knowledge System (PKS) and Foundation Fieldbus at the Molikpaq platform on the Sakhalin shelf, Russia. -

Unitronics PLC controls Brewery in New Hampshire
The PLC supports temperature measurement in three, 800 gallon fermenters, records batch data, and automates the circulation pump, transfer pump and 300,000 btu Boiler. -
